Florida Statutes Section 552.42 - Appeal. (Fla. Stat. § 552.42)

552.42 Appeal.—The petitioner or the respondent may appeal the final order of the administrative law judge to the district court of appeal with jurisdiction over the county where the hearing was held by filing a notice, accompanied by the required filing fee, as provided by the Florida Rules of Appellate Procedure. The payment of any award shall be stayed during the pendency of an appeal.

History.—s. 7, ch. 2003-62.
